Walkoff HR beats Miracle, 4-2
The Fort Myers Miracle carried a 2-1 lead into the bottom of the ninth inning, but a two-out RBI single by Palm Beach’s Josh Garcia sent Friday’s game into extra innings.
In the 10th, Cardinals first-baseman Xavier Scruggs hit a two-out, two-run homer off of Miracle reliever Billy Bullock to give the Cardinals a 4-2 win.
It is the second straight defeat for the Miracle (2-6) after winning two in a row earlier this week in Charlotte.
With the game tied 1-1 in the top of the ninth, Miracle designated hitter Michael Harrington hit a go-ahead RBI-double to the fence in left that scored Chris Herrmann from first.
Bullock walked a batter with one out in the ninth, before allowing another base hit to put a runner in scoring position. Garcia picked up the clutch hit to tie the game 2-2. Matt Carpenter followed with a base hit to right, but Evan Bigley threw out Thomas Pham at the plate to extend the game into extra-innings.
Bullock, in his third appearance with the Miracle, was charged with the loss.
Garcia finished 5-for-5 on the night, including a first-inning solo home run that gave the Cardinals an early 1-0 lead. Fort Myers tied the game in the fourth on a fielder’s choice groundout by Ramon Santana.
The Miracle and Cardinals square off again Saturday night and Sunday before the Miracle return home to Hammond Stadium to open a three-game series with the Stone Crabs Monday night.
